Choose relevant papers

Choose five relevant papers from a supplied list of 20.

Sonnet 5·4 examples·One attempt with each setup·2026-09-15

No difference observed

All three conditions reached 43.8% mean recall. Perfect selection from these lists could reach only 50%.

Skill tested: K-Dense: literature-review ↗. “AI alone” uses the task instructions and required tools; the other setups add a checklist or skill guidance. Everything else is held the same.

How this was scored, and what it does not establish

Recall is the share of known cited sources recovered in the five selected papers, averaged across cases. The supplied candidate lists limit how high this score can go.

  • Two of four candidate pools contain no known target source.
  • The target set contains published cited sources, not exhaustive relevance judgments.
  • This tests fixed-list reranking; searching databases and writing a literature review were not exercised.
